As a result, understanding various order types is an important first step in learning to trade futures. Market Order – A market order is a basic order type that instructs the broker to buy or sell at the best available price. Market orders are considered to be the most immediate way to enter or exit a ...

The Soybean futures contract trades in 0.0025 (1/4) cent increments. As each contract is equal to 5,000 bushells of Soybeans, a 0.0025 price move equates to $12.50 (0.0025 x 5,000). If Soybean prices were to move up or down 0.0475 points, that would equate to $237.50 +/-. For this example, let’s assume you went long (bought) one (1) November ... You can set up a stop-loss in two ways:A futures contract is a legally binding agreement to buy or sell a standardized asset on a specific date or during a specific month. Typically, futures contracts are traded electronically on exchanges such as CME Group, the largest futures exchange in the U.S. Most futures contracts are “standardized,” or effectively interchangeable, and ...
